How to keep Slack active in the browser

The method we are going to explore is through a tool called Slack Off. This is a simple tool that works through Slack Legacy Tokens. But what is Slack Token?

In the past when Slack had no app integration, legacy tokens were used to make calls to the Web API.

Since then, apps have replaced this integration method. However, some tools still require these tokens to integrate, and the SlackOff tool is one of them.

Now that we’ve defined what a Slack token is, let’s see how to use the SlackOff app.

How to use SlackOff

Step 1: Open the website and sign up for this service by clicking the Try it out button.

Here, the email ID you sign up with is not necessarily the one you use to sign in to Slack.

Step 2: Once logged in, click Add Team, which will redirect you to the Add Slack Team page. This is where you need to add the token.

Here, tap the link that says ‘API Token Here’ to generate your Slack Token. Alternatively, you can also click the link below.

Remember to sign in to your Slack account when you try the above step.

Step 3: On the Slack Legacy token generator page, scroll down until you see your workspace and username.

If this is your first time using this service, the Token will show as 0. Click the Issue Token button.

Step 4: Once you have copied the newly generated token, go back to Slack Off and paste the token number in the text box.

Next, click Add group.

Step 4: Once the token is verified, you will be redirected to the homepage of SlackOff, where you will find your workspace name and with Schedule set to Always Online. And that’s pretty much it!

From now on, you will always appear Online, the green light will be on as you do your daily work. In fact, SlackOff will show you as online even if you’re actually inactive, and that’s the only problem with the free version of Slack Off.

So, before you sign out for the day, remember to set the status to Away. Next time you load or reload Slack, it will ask you for the new status. All you need to do is keep it Active, that’s it.

This limitation will be removed if you upgrade to the paid version of SlackOff. The paid version for $1.99/month comes with a nifty option to organize your time.

Thankfully, you can try the trial version (requires credit card information) before investing.

So if you’re a freelancer who only works on certain days, you can set your schedule accordingly.

To set your schedule, click the name of your workspace in Slack and adjust the time to your preferences, then hit the Save button.

If for some reason you feel that you can do without being active all the time, just delete the group.

Privacy issues?

The makers of SlackOff state that they do not share any information publicly or with third parties. But in the long run, if you stop using SlackOff, remember to revoke the token. Note that Slack will automatically revoke old tokens if not used for a long time.
